◇History of Umeyama Kiln◇
Tobe ware has a long history, with porcelain production beginning in 1775.
Baizan Kiln was opened by Umeno Masagoro in 1882 and has grown through trade not only within Japan but also overseas, particularly with Southeast Asia, India, and America.
In order to rebuild after the Pacific War, from 1953 to 1959, Umeno Takenosuke received guidance from Mingei movement advocates Yanagi Muneyoshi, Hamada Shoji, Tomimoto Kenkichi, Suzuki Shigeo, and Fujimoto Yoshimichi, and through repeated trial and error with Sawada Jun, Iwahashi Setsu, Kudo Shoji and others, perfected Baizan Kiln\'s unique handmade, hand-painted techniques.
Even today, the kiln continues to produce practical crafts in pursuit of \"use and beauty.\"
